Nacogdoches Police Department, Texas
End of Watch Thursday, December 2, 1948
Add to My HeroesBennett T. Spradley
Patrolman Spradley was shot and killed after responding to a disturbance.
Patrolman Spradley was assigned at East Main Street and North Mound Street to direct traffic during the Nacogdoches Christmas parade on December 2, 1948. After the parade, there was a disturbance at a nearby small clothing shop. Patrolman Spradley was summoned and the man who was causing problems shot Patrolman Spradley with a shotgun. Patrolman Spradley was able to return two rounds, but it did not affect the shooter.
Patrolman Spradley was taken to Memorial Hospital where he died from his injuries. The shooter was convicted of the murder and was sentenced to three years in prison but was pardoned by the governor after serving only one year.
Patrolman Spradley was due to retire in three weeks at the time of his death. He was survived by his wife.
